I would like to know if you can make a brush created with a graphics follow the pressure curves, like you can with a mouse? As I really like the appeal of the thin tip and thick middle. When I draw the lines with a brush, it obviously creates it's own pressure curve based on the true pressure, is there a way to disable this, so that it follows the saved pressure curve under the stroke settings?.

Just set the 'Controller' on the context toolbar of the Pencil (or Vector Brush) Tool to 'None' and it will act as though you're inputting with a mouse :)
